Output 2e4bd68d04fd5f0ae27f64d4a7b76890c268238a73aacf41c3b9abe3b0a8f59a:1

value
1198721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d500efd5306897bc746fab355a9bc3aa5484ca9a OP_EQUAL
address
3M7GyVmnHXW4uKcxJ1BVfgnLHwA5atXCj9
transaction
2e4bd68d04fd5f0ae27f64d4a7b76890c268238a73aacf41c3b9abe3b0a8f59a
confirmations
266757
spent
true